Magnussen explains Turn 10 crash

 XPB Images Haas' Kevin Magnussen damaged his VF-17's front wing this morning when he locked up the rear under braking and hit the wall at Turn 10. Despite the mishap, the Dane says it will not impact the team's Monday test program. "I completely locked the rears,” he said. “The same as pulling a handbrake in a road car! So I lost the rear and spun and brushed the wall so we had some damage in the front wing. "No drama at all, just stuff like brake balance and brake maps is what we’re here to sort out.
